Dopamine is important for working memory and drug that increases the level of dopamine in the brain or facilities the action of dopamine, enhances working memory capabilities.Dopamine helps to maintain the ongoing information in the face of interference by signaling when the information in working memory should be updated. It is suggested that anatomy of the dopamine system is such that dopamine-producing cells have a strong connection to the prefrontal cortex- the brain region that is considered most important for protecting maintained information from distraction.
